package com.krrishg.config;
import org.junit.jupiter.api.AfterEach;
import org.junit.jupiter.api.BeforeEach;
import org.junit.jupiter.api.Test;
import java.io.IOException;
import java.nio.file.Files;
import java.nio.file.Path;
import static org.junit.jupiter.api.Assertions.*;
class EncryptionServiceTest {
private Path tempKeyPath;
private EncryptionService service;
@BeforeEach
void setUp() {
try {
tempKeyPath = Files.createTempFile("test-encryption", ".key");
service = new EncryptionService(tempKeyPath.toString());
service.init();
} catch (Exception e) {
throw new RuntimeException(e);
}
}
@AfterEach
void tearDown() throws IOException {
Files.deleteIfExists(tempKeyPath);
}
@Test
void encryptAndDecryptRoundtrip() {
String plaintext = "Hello, World!";
String encrypted = service.encrypt(plaintext);
assertNotNull(encrypted);
assertNotEquals(plaintext, encrypted);
String decrypted = service.decrypt(encrypted);
assertEquals(plaintext, decrypted);
}
@Test
void encryptAndDecryptSpecialCharacters() {
String plaintext = "Special chars: !@#$%^&*()_+-=[]{}|;':\",./<>?`~\n\t";
String encrypted = service.encrypt(plaintext);
String decrypted = service.decrypt(encrypted);
assertEquals(plaintext, decrypted);
}
@Test
void encryptAndDecryptEmptyString() {
String encrypted = service.encrypt("");
String decrypted = service.decrypt(encrypted);
assertEquals("", decrypted);
}
@Test
void differentPlaintextsProduceDifferentCiphertexts() {
String encrypted1 = service.encrypt("text1");
String encrypted2 = service.encrypt("text2");
assertNotEquals(encrypted1, encrypted2);
}
@Test
void samePlaintextProducedDifferentCiphertextsDueToRandomIv() {
String encrypted1 = service.encrypt("same text");
String encrypted2 = service.encrypt("same text");
assertNotEquals(encrypted1, encrypted2);
}
@Test
void decryptThrowsOnInvalidData() {
assertThrows(RuntimeException.class, () -> service.decrypt("invalid-base64!"));
}
@Test
void initCreatesKeyFile() throws IOException {
assertTrue(Files.exists(tempKeyPath));
assertTrue(Files.size(tempKeyPath) > 0);
}
@Test
void initLoadsExistingKeyFile() {
EncryptionService secondService = new EncryptionService(tempKeyPath.toString());
secondService.init();
String plaintext = "Persistent key test";
String encrypted = secondService.encrypt(plaintext);
String decrypted = secondService.decrypt(encrypted);
assertEquals(plaintext, decrypted);
}
}
